Ticket: Drift detected in Tilegrave prefetcher config. Plugin authors: the prefetch radius and zoom-band limits on the shared cluster no longer match the published contract. Someone bumped concurrency and radius manually during the Veldmark incident and never reverted. If your plugin throttles requests based on documented defaults, expect cache misses and rate-limit errors until we reconcile. Do not hardcode workarounds; we'll restore canonical values this week. For visibility, the values currently live on the cluster are these.

deployment values, hahip-kajep:
HOLAX_PIN=4003
HOLAX_METRICS_HOST=metrics.holax.zemvarworks.internal
HOLAX_LOG_LEVEL=warn
HOLAX_TENANT=fraael

Ticket: Telemetry gateway v3 cutover

The Harrowfield telemetry gateway moves to the v3 schema next release. Plugin payloads must declare units explicitly; unversioned payloads will be rejected. Compatibility shim lasts one cycle only. Cutover is blocked pending sign-off. Approval authority is held by the engineer named below.

named custodian: Brivan Eliath Quenox Frador

Current state: 28 partners, three regions, standard margin 22%, premium tier 30% with volume commitments. Renewal rate last year: 84%. Two partner exits pending in the Calverton region; replacements identified. Training certification is now mandatory before partner activation. Budget for partner enablement is flat year-on-year. Disputes are handled under the standard arbitration clause. Programme review scheduled for next planning cycle. The confidential business-plan note follows below.

board note of hadup-kafog: Only 28 of the 553 pilot accounts renewed Kelox, so a churn review is set for March 17. Jorirek Logistics is in early talks to buy Raldorox Works for about $233.6 million.